WWE Champion John Cena is set to battle it out against long-time rival CM Punk at Night of Champions in Saudi Arabia later this month. The two rivals faced off against each other during the latest episode of Monday Night RAW, and a match between the two was made official.
Cena is currently in the midst of his 'farewell tour' in WWE and is facing off against his iconic rivals one by one. His first title defense came against Randy Orton at Backlash before he took out R-Truth during Saturday Night's Main Event in a non-title match.
Speaking about the Cena vs. Punk clash at Night of Champions during the latest episode of WrestleVotes Q&A on Sportskeeda WrestleBinge, Bill Apter claimed that R-Truth might get involved in the match between the two.
"I think it has to be R-Truth and John Cena, no matter what the storyline, no matter what the angle is. Right now, their focus is on the match with CM Punk, promoting the Saudi Arabia thing. Somehow, they've got to have some interaction with Cena and Ron Killings during the weeks leading up to that and maybe Ron Killings interferes and cause John Cena the title in Saudi Arabia," Apter said. The former United States champion recently faced off against John Cena in a non-title match at Saturday Night's Main Event. Truth would even cost Cena in his tag team match against Cody Rhodes and Jey Uso at Money in the Bank.
